Depression and Anxiety Treatment

Many people experience depression and anxiety simultaneously. In fact, chronic pain syndromes such as fibromyalgia and irritable bowel syndrome often include anxiety symptoms as well as pain.

Treatment for depression and anxiety includes psychotherapy, medication, and lifestyle changes. A mental health professional can help you find the most effective strategies for you.

Cognitive-behavioral therapy

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) is a type of psychotherapy that helps people manage depression and anxiety. During CBT sessions therapists help people identify negative patterns of behavior and thinking. Therapists then teach strategies to help change these patterns. Therapists also encourage patients to practice their new skills at home.

Cognitive-behavioral therapy is based upon the notion that your thoughts, feelings, and physical sensations are connected. Negative thoughts, for example can trigger negative emotions, which can lead to self-destructive behaviors. CBT teaches people to identify these destructive cycles and break them. Therapists can also teach their clients strategies for coping that can aid them in coping with negative emotions.

If you are suffering from social phobia, you may find it difficult to connect with other people in certain situations. This could cause you to avoid interactions which can lead to isolation and loneliness. CBT can help you identify the reason you feel like this and teach you how to overcome social anxiety.

Your therapist will begin by identifying the thoughts that are not helping you that trigger your depression and anxiety. Then, they will help you change these thoughts and behaviors so that you can enjoy more positive outlook on life. You could also be assigned "homework" to test your new skills. These techniques may include imagining anxiety-provoking situations or practicing the conversation with your friends.

Acupuncture

Western medicine's treatment of anxiety and depressive disorders is centered around psychotherapy and prescription drugs. While these treatments have scientific support however, they're not suitable for everyone and can cause unpleasant adverse side consequences. Patients seek alternative treatments to alleviate their symptoms. Exercise, dietary changes and mindfulness techniques such as meditation are just a few of the alternatives to treatment. Acupuncture can be combined alongside psychotherapy and medication.

Acupuncture works by stimulating the sensory nerves, which send signals to the brain. This can reduce pain and relieve symptoms of anxiety or depression. It can also trigger the release of endorphins, which are the body's natural painkillers. In an acupuncture session, a trained practitioner inserts needles that resemble threads and is inserted into specific areas of the human body. Medication

While some medications can be used to treat depression and anxiety however, one should not be treated only by taking medication. The use of medications should be part of a larger treatment plan that includes behavioral and psychotherapy. It is also crucial to make sure that the right kind of medication is prescribed. Antidepressants for instance can cause side effects like dry mouth or upset stomach. To find out more about the adverse effects and how you can lessen them, it is important to talk to a healthcare professional.

Although determining if you have depression or anxiety disorder can be difficult, a variety of treatments are available. The most commonly used treatments are selective serotonin inhibitors (SSRIs). These medications help increase the amount of serotonin in the brain, which can improve mood and feelings of wellbeing. They also can reduce symptoms, such as anxiety and insomnia. SSRIs are considered to be the first-line treatment for depression and anxiety. Benzodiazepines are also a possibility, but they are addicting and should be avoided when at all possible.

Counseling

A therapist can help you deal with anxiety and depression using a variety of talk therapies. They may also suggest changes in lifestyle to boost your mood. A Therapist will ask you to describe your symptoms and how your condition has affected your life, so they are able to better understand it. They might also request blood, urine or other tests to rule out underlying health issues that could trigger anxiety or depression.

Your therapist may suggest a multi-disciplinary approach to treatment, as what relieves depression symptoms may not necessarily reduce anxiety and vice the reverse. While c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), teaches you how to recognize and overcome negative thoughts and behaviors and thoughts, interpersonal therapy focuses more on learning how to communicate and express your emotions more effectively. Behavioural activation therapy is designed to assist you in making positive changes in your life to boost your mood. Exposure therapy, a method which teaches you to confront the things you fear and helps treat phobias.
